Why the Online Version Feels Less Intimidating
The old version of baccarat could feel uncomfortable before a person even placed a bet. High minimums, formal table etiquette, and the atmosphere of luxury often made newcomers feel as though they needed insider knowledge just to participate. Online play removes much of that pressure. The game becomes easier to approach when the setting is private, the controls are clear, and the stakes can be much smaller.
That accessibility matters. A player can learn the basics in minutes, since the choice is usually limited to Player, Banker, or Tie. There is no long list of complicated decisions to master before joining in. In that sense, baccarat suits people who want a straightforward game that still feels polished and fast.
Live Dealer Play Changed the Experience
The biggest leap forward came with live dealer formats. Instead of relying only on static software, online casinos began broadcasting real tables with real dealers through high-quality video. The result is a setting that keeps the human element while removing the need to travel to a physical venue.
This format also helps recreate the sense of trust that many players want. Seeing the cards dealt in real time makes the experience feel transparent and immediate. For many users, that blend of convenience and authenticity is exactly what the game needed to grow beyond its old audience.
Faster Rounds, Faster Attention
Modern players often expect entertainment to move quickly, and baccarat has adapted well to that expectation. Speed-based versions shorten each round and keep the rhythm tight, which makes the game feel more energetic without changing its core rules. That pace suits mobile users especially well, since they may be playing in short bursts rather than sitting down for a long session.
No commission versions have also helped make the game feel less complicated. By simplifying the payout structure, they reduce the amount of math a casual player has to think about. The overall effect is cleaner and more direct, which makes the game easier to enjoy.
How Digital Features Add More Depth
Even though baccarat is simple at its core, online platforms have added layers that keep it interesting. Trend trackers, side bets, chat features, and visual card-reveal effects give the experience more personality. These additions do not replace the main game; they make it feel richer and more social.
One of the clearest examples is the way digital tables display past results and patterns. Many players enjoy following the flow of a session, even if those patterns do not change the underlying odds. The visual design creates a stronger sense of momentum, which helps the game feel active rather than repetitive.
